摘要

The self-assembly of highly organized metal-organic frameworks comprised of metal ions as nodes and bridged ligands as spacers has achieved considerable progress in supramolecular chemistry and material chemistry. The increasing interest in this field is not only because of their intriguing variety of architectures and topologies, but also because of their potential applications as functional materials.
